国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

python怎樣選出最大的數(shù)

在編程過(guò)程中,處理列表是一種常見(jiàn)的操作。有時(shí)候,我們需要從已知的列表中找到最大的數(shù)值。Python編程語(yǔ)言提供了多種方法來(lái)實(shí)現(xiàn)這個(gè)目標(biāo)。接下來(lái),將詳細(xì)介紹幾種常用的方法,以及它們的優(yōu)劣勢(shì)。方法一:使用

在編程過(guò)程中,處理列表是一種常見(jiàn)的操作。有時(shí)候,我們需要從已知的列表中找到最大的數(shù)值。Python編程語(yǔ)言提供了多種方法來(lái)實(shí)現(xiàn)這個(gè)目標(biāo)。接下來(lái),將詳細(xì)介紹幾種常用的方法,以及它們的優(yōu)劣勢(shì)。

方法一:使用內(nèi)置函數(shù)max()

首先,可以使用Python內(nèi)置的max()函數(shù)來(lái)找到列表中的最大數(shù)值。這個(gè)函數(shù)非常方便,只需要將列表作為參數(shù)傳入即可。例如:

```

numbers [1, 4, 2, 9, 5]

max_number max(numbers)

print(max_number)

```

上述代碼將輸出9,即列表中的最大數(shù)值。

方法二:使用循環(huán)遍歷

另一種常見(jiàn)的方法是使用循環(huán)遍歷列表,并利用一個(gè)變量來(lái)記錄當(dāng)前最大的數(shù)值。

```

numbers [1, 4, 2, 9, 5]

max_number numbers[0] # 假設(shè)列表中的第一個(gè)數(shù)為最大值

for number in numbers:

if number > max_number:

max_number number

print(max_number)

```

上述代碼也將輸出9,即列表中的最大數(shù)值。

方法三:使用排序

還可以通過(guò)對(duì)列表進(jìn)行排序,然后取得最后一個(gè)元素即可獲得最大的數(shù)值。

```

numbers [1, 4, 2, 9, 5]

() # 對(duì)列表進(jìn)行排序,默認(rèn)從小到大排序

max_number numbers[-1] # 取得最后一個(gè)元素

print(max_number)

```

同樣地,上述代碼也將輸出9,即列表中的最大數(shù)值。

綜上所述,我們介紹了三種常用的方法來(lái)查找列表中的最大數(shù)值,并提供了相應(yīng)的代碼示例和解釋。根據(jù)實(shí)際情況和編程需求,可以選擇適合自己的方法來(lái)解決問(wèn)題。在編寫(xiě)代碼時(shí),需要考慮算法復(fù)雜度和效率,并選擇最合適的方法來(lái)優(yōu)化程序。

總結(jié):

Python編程語(yǔ)言提供了多種方法來(lái)查找列表中的最大數(shù)值??梢允褂脙?nèi)置函數(shù)max()、循環(huán)遍歷或排序等方式來(lái)實(shí)現(xiàn)。在實(shí)際應(yīng)用中,需要考慮算法復(fù)雜度和效率,并選擇最合適的方法來(lái)優(yōu)化程序。希望本文能夠幫助讀者更好地理解和應(yīng)用Python編程語(yǔ)言中的列表操作技巧。